About Cihan Duran
Cihan Duran is a scholar working on Surgery,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ine,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ine, Radiology, Nuclear Medicine and Imaging and Hepatology, having authored 85 papers that have together received 1.4k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Organ Transplantation Techniques and Outcomes (14 papers), Liver Disease and Transplantation (11 papers), Cardiac Imaging and Diagnostics (10 papers), Cardiac Arrhythmias and Treatments (7 papers), Organ Donation and Transplantation (7 papers), Coronary Artery Anomalies (7 papers), Cardiac Structural Anomalies and Repair (6 papers) and Renal cell carcinoma treatment (6 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Hepatology (227 citations), Surgery (854 citations), Pathology and Forensic Medicine (306 citations),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ine (388 citations) and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ine (225 citations). Cihan Duran has collaborated with scholars based in Türkiye, United States and India. Frequent co-authors include Mustafa Şirvancı, Çağatay Öztürk, Mehmet Aydoğan, Mecit Kantarcı, Yıldıray Yüzer, Yaman Tokat, Murat Dayangaç, Azmi Hamzaoğlu, Kürşat Ganiyusufoğlu and Mona Bhatia. Their work appears in journals such as Acta Radiologica, Journal of Computer Assisted Tomography, American Journal of Roentgenology, Liver Transplantation and Cardiovascular Pathology.
